
The immersive installation, "Time for tea", will take place over nine days in September, throughout London Design Festival.
Dutch design duo Scholten & Baijings is delivering a take on the ritual of tea, set on a six-metre-long table and featuring more than 80 products.
Fortnum’s iconic Eau de Nil colour is providing the inspiration for the installation, with all furniture and products designed by Scholten & Baijings bearing the distinctive green hue. These will include a marble floor and tables in Eau and green upholstered chairs furnished by the brands Hay, Moroso and Karimoku.
Fortnum & Mason is also developiong a porcelain tea set for the installation.
London Design Festival is taking place from 15 to 23 September.
